Grill Delete install question
 
I can not seem to get the bottom piece of the grill delete on...there is not enough room to screw on the four screws. Should i remove the headlights so i can make more space or is there anything else i can do?

CCM 06-05-2006 01:53 PM

You're not supposed to use the stock screws, you're just supposed to stick the little prongs on the bottom of the black piece through the stock screw holes and then use speed nuts to fasten it to the bumper. The only screws you need to use are on the top (near the headlights). And yes, it's a bit easier to reach if you remove both headlights.

I didnt re-use those four 7mm screws at all...the only thing that holds the bottom piece on is the plastic rivets, one on each side. The bottom of the piece has four pins that fit into where those PITA 7mm screws were...I guess there are supposed to be fascia clips in the kit, but I never got any...it just sits in those holes...I dunno 130mph and nothing came loose.
